The Evolution of NBA 2K Ratings
The NBA 2K franchise has long been a staple in the gaming community, celebrated for its realistic gameplay and in-depth player ratings. Every year, players and fans eagerly anticipate the release of player ratings, which often spark intense debates and discussions. These ratings reflect each player’s performance, potential, and overall impact on the game, but they also lead to significant controversies, particularly concerning underrated players.
Understanding Player Ratings
Player ratings in NBA 2K are determined through various factors, including:
- Player statistics from the previous season
- Performance in high-stakes games
- Injury history
- Player potential and progression trends
Despite these calculations, fans often feel that some players do not receive fair ratings, leading to heated discussions on forums and social media.
Highlighting Underrated Players in NBA 2K
Underrated players can significantly impact the game, yet they often fly under the radar in terms of ratings. Here are some notable players frequently cited as underrated in NBA 2K:
1. De’Aaron Fox
Despite showcasing immense talent and leadership skills as the Sacramento Kings’ point guard, De’Aaron Fox often receives ratings that do not fully reflect his growth and contributions on the court.
2. Jaren Jackson Jr.
Known for his defensive prowess and shot-blocking ability, Jaren Jackson Jr. has been a key player for the Memphis Grizzlies. His impact on both ends of the floor often gets overlooked, leading to lower ratings than expected.
3. Michael Porter Jr.
Michael Porter Jr. possesses a rare combination of size and shooting ability. However, inconsistency in performance has led to fluctuating ratings, which may not represent his true potential.
4. Malik Beasley
Beasley has proven to be a valuable scorer, particularly in his role with the Minnesota Timberwolves. His contributions as a sixth man often do not get recognized in his ratings.
5. C.J. McCollum
C.J. McCollum’s scoring ability and playmaking have been pivotal for the Portland Trail Blazers. Despite his skills, he is often overshadowed by star teammates, leading to undervalued ratings.

Annual Rating Controversies
Debate and Discussion
Every year, NBA 2K’s ratings trigger debates among players and fans alike. The controversies often stem from:
- Player Performance: A player having a breakout season may not see a corresponding increase in their rating, leading to fan outrage.
- Injuries: Injuries can derail a player’s season, impacting their rating. However, dedicated fans feel that past performances should weigh heavily in the ratings process.
- Media Influence: Players who receive a lot of media coverage may get inflated ratings, overshadowing other deserving players.
